We are thrilled to launch our 4th run of the Pope Youth Film Festival (PYFF)! Our festival was founded by late filmmaker Paul L Pope as an initiative to encourage the province’s youth to take an interest in and develop creative skills in making films, and to highlight those efforts with a festival. We have been thrilled with the projects we have seen!
PYFF once again extends an invitation to all youth between the ages of 12 – 19 to create and submit an original short film. All the films submitted will be showcased on our YouTube channel and the winners of each category will be screened at the Majestic Theatre in St. John’s on March 12th . We invite anyone who submitted a film to join us!
And now for prizes! We will have CA$H prizes of $250 for each category winner, plus an overall winner taking home the grand prize of $1000.00. We also have honorable craft awards and certificates in other categories awarded that evening.
